Natural gas Power in Vermont
Net generation and share of the state power mix, 2025 — U.S. Energy Information Administration.
Natural gas generation (2025)
1 thousand MWh
Share of state power mix
0.05%
National rank (natural gas output)
#50
U.S. average share
40.8%
Natural gas share of Vermont's power mix over time
2001: 0.2% → 2025: 0.05%
Year by year
| Year | Natural gas (thousand MWh) | Share of state mix |
|---|---|---|
| 2025 | 1 | 0.05% |
| 2024 | 1 | 0.05% |
| 2023 | 1 | 0.05% |
| 2022 | 2 | 0.07% |
| 2021 | 2 | 0.1% |
| 2020 | 2 | 0.09% |
| 2019 | 2 | 0.08% |
| 2018 | 2 | 0.08% |
| 2017 | 2 | 0.08% |
| 2016 | 2 | 0.1% |
| 2015 | 1 | 0.08% |
| 2014 | 2 | 0.03% |
| 2013 | 3 | 0.04% |
| 2012 | 3 | 0.04% |
| 2011 | 3 | 0.05% |
| 2010 | 4 | 0.06% |
| 2009 | 4 | 0.06% |
| 2008 | 3 | 0.04% |
| 2007 | 2 | 0.03% |
| 2006 | 2 | 0.03% |
| 2005 | 2 | 0.04% |
| 2004 | 3 | 0.06% |
| 2003 | 2 | 0.03% |
| 2002 | 3 | 0.06% |
| 2001 | 11 | 0.2% |
Source: U.S. Energy Information Administration, electric power operational data (net generation by state and energy source). "Share of state mix" is this fuel's net generation as a percentage of all in-state net generation.
